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Praia da Vagueira is easily accessible by road from Aveiro. You can drive, take a taxi, or look into local bus services. The journey is relatively short, offering scenic coastal views along the way.
Yes, Praia da Vagueira is well-signposted in the Vagos municipality. If using GPS, simply input 'Praia da Vagueira' and you should arrive without issues.
The village itself is quite walkable, especially the area around the beach and the fishing port. For exploring further afield, a car offers the most flexibility, though local transport options exist.
While direct public transport might be limited, you can often connect via buses from Aveiro to Vagos, and then take a local connection or taxi to Praia da Vagueira. Check local schedules for the most up-to-date information.
The nearest train station is in Aveiro. From Aveiro, you would need to arrange onward travel by bus, taxi, or rental car to reach Praia da Vagueira.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, access to Praia da Vagueira beach itself is free of charge. You can enjoy the sands and sea without any admission fees.
The Espaço Museológico da Praia da Vagueira is typically open daily from 10:00 AM to 1:00 PM and 2:00 PM to 6:00 PM. It's always a good idea to confirm hours before your visit.
Information regarding ticket prices for the Espaço Museológico da Praia da Vagueira is not widely available, but it's generally an affordable local attraction. Check their official channels for current pricing.
Praia da Vagueira sometimes hosts local events and activities, like the game mentioned in one reel. Keep an eye on local event listings for any upcoming happenings.
Yes, there is usually parking available near the beach and within the village, though it can get busy during peak season.
